Chapter 40 The Secret of Wind and Rain
"The person who turned the disciples of the Wind and Rain Sect into this state and arrested me is the same person. This person is the former deputy sect leader of the Wind and Rain Sect, my younger brother, Xi Hui."
Xi Ming looked somewhat dazed. Although it came from his own mouth, he still couldn't quite believe it.
In his memory, Xi Hui, who was always gentle, polite, and humble, could never be the madman who broke his limbs with a savage grin and locked him in a cave.
But it was him.
“You should know about my relationship with Brother Bourne, so…”
"Wait, what's the relationship? And who is Brother Bourne?" Xuan Yi asked with a serious expression, completely unaware of the interruption.
Li Hengzhi said with some helplessness, "Our sect leader is named Qin Boen, and his wife and Senior Xi's wife are twin sisters."
"Oh, so old man Qin's name is Qin Boen." Xuan Yi suddenly realized, and then, as if remembering something, turned to Jiang Si and whispered, "I thought the leader of Kunlun Ruins married someone from your Qingfeng Sword Sect."
Jiang Si: "Before the two ladies married, they were indeed disciples of the Qingfeng Sword Sect."
"Oh, I see. Well, that's alright then." Xuan Yi smiled somewhat awkwardly. "Continue, continue. So, what's wrong?"
Xi Ming continued, "So... Brother Bourne and I also know the secret on each other's screens. We swore that we would never reveal it to anyone until the very last moment."
“But three years ago, after Zhenzhen’s wedding banquet, I was so excited that I ran to Zhenzhen’s mother’s grave and poured out all the things that had happened over the years. I even got completely drunk. But who would have thought that Xi Hui, who came looking for me, would hear everything I said to Zhenzhen’s mother.”
"The next day, after I sobered up, I realized that I had said something wrong. I immediately went to find Xi Hui. Fortunately, Xi Hui hadn't heard everything. He only knew that I had a map about the Seven Star Stones and that the location was Qixia Mountain. So I went along with it and repeatedly told him not to tell anyone what I had heard the night before. At the time, I thought that Xi Hui was a good person, and he had also sworn a solemn oath, so I thought that the matter was over."
Little did they know, this was the beginning of a nightmare.
Xi Hui was a child his father brought back from outside. Although his mother didn't seem to care much about him on the surface, she always provided him with the same food, clothing, and daily necessities. She even directly informed the entire household that Xi Hui would be the second young master of the household from now on.
He genuinely treated Xi Hui like a younger brother, and whenever he encountered something good, he would think of Xi Hui first.
Even after his father passed away, when he took over as the leader of the Wind and Rain Sect, he gave Xi Hui the power of a deputy leader, second only to the leader.
But who could have imagined that Xi Hui was like an ungrateful wretch, and that his ambitions went far beyond that?
Since Xi Hui learned of the existence of the "Seven Star Strange Stone Map," things have been calm on the surface, but behind the scenes he has been doing countless shady things.
Upon hearing this, Li Hengzhi said, "It seems that the old man wearing a veil and a black robe that we encountered when we entered the mountain was Xi Hui."
Bai Heming nodded in agreement, "No wonder he covered himself up from beginning to end; I'm afraid his face would expose his identity."
Thinking of Xi Hui's attire when he was captured, Xi Ming became even more certain: "It really is him. There is a Gu Master who was exiled to the Southern Frontier by Xi Hui's side. I don't know what Xi Hui promised him, but this Southern Frontier man listens to him very much. The Gu on the disciples of the Wind and Rain Sect and the poisonous fog in the mountains were all caused by this Gu Master."
“This person is extremely ugly, and…” Xi Ming hesitated for a moment, “and he also has some shameful and unusual fetishes.”
"I know, I know, you have a fondness for beautiful women." Xuan Yi said somewhat dismissively, "Man Niang seemed to have mentioned it when she captured me and Jiang Si."
After listening, Bai Heming pursed his thin lips, his whole body tensed up, and his eyes darted around anxiously.
Thinking back to when he and Li Hengzhi had accidentally stumbled upon the Southern Border Gu Master engaging in sexual intercourse with a man and a woman deep within the dense forest, a blush crept onto his originally fair face.
Xuan Yi didn't think too much about it, but instead a new problem arose.
"Exiled to southern Xinjiang?"
Bai Heming shook his head, seemingly trying to shake off the image. Then, forcing himself back to the main point, he explained, "Although the Southern Frontier is known for its Gu poison, it is relatively unharmed. Local Gu masters even use Gu poison to treat illnesses and injuries. I think this exiled person has probably refined some evil and vicious secret Gu, violated a major taboo in the Southern Frontier, and resorted to any means for profit, which is why he was exiled."
"No wonder Jiang Si and I encountered those men in black lining up to bleed us in the mountains. They must be quite something to use so much blood," Xuan Yi couldn't help but sigh.
"This blood is used to nourish the Blood Gu, which is the Gu that is placed on the disciples. Back then, Xi Hui put the Gu source into the disciples' wells, and by the time the disciples showed abnormalities, it was too late."
Jiang Si: "Besides this man from the southern border, who is that woman?"
Xi Ming pondered for a moment, “I don’t know Man Niang’s origins. She only appeared after I was imprisoned. Besides the golden bell on her body that can control those piranhas, I also heard that she discovered something in the deep mountains, which is why she has her current status.”
"Haha, don't be nervous." Xi Ming said with a smile, noticing the obvious change in the expressions of the people around him.
"What was discovered was an ancient site. The entire site was a huge disc, embedded in the floor of a cave deep in the mountains. The entire site was covered with countless bronze patterns, but these patterns were completely irregular and engraved with some incomprehensible designs and characters. Xi Hui and Man Niang must have guessed that this object was directly related to the Jade Balance Stone, but no one could turn this giant disc, so the Jade Balance Stone had not yet fallen into the hands of the thieves. Otherwise, they wouldn't have sent so many troops to guard Qixia Mountain."
“Senior, I have another question.” Bai Heming recalled the way a man in black addressed him when Xi Hui led his men to besiege them.
"Is there someone else behind Xi Hui? Because when we were being chased by Xi Hui, I personally heard a man in black call Xi Hui 'elder.' If Xi Hui is just setting up his own faction, then the title 'elder' is really strange?"
Li Hengzhi agreed, saying, "It's possible. The person behind Xi Hui who could instruct Xi Hui to arrest us must be quite powerful."
“That’s not all.” Jiang Si’s expression was somewhat grim. “Since Xi Hui has pledged allegiance to this person, he must have also told this person about the clues regarding the Seven Star Stones. The Qixia Mountain incident is probably just the beginning.”
"Senior, do you still have that screen?" Xuan Yi asked, but he felt there was little hope.
"Don't worry, young friend, I've placed the token in a very safe place."
"Now that the token is safe, the martial world is likely to descend into chaos." Xuan Yi crossed his arms and leaned against the wall behind him.
"That thief knew about the existence of the screen. Would he be satisfied with just Qixia Mountain? He's not stupid. Since the Wind and Rain Sect has a token, other sects might have one too."
Speaking of this, Xuan Yi couldn't help but click his tongue, "Especially for orthodox sects like your Kunlun Ruins and Qingfeng Sword Sect, which have been around for centuries, don't let someone raid your base."
Jiang Si and Li Hengzhi looked somewhat solemn. Although Xuan Yi's words were unpleasant to hear, they had their reasons. After leaving the mountain, they needed to send a message back to the sect as soon as possible.
Xuan Yi patted Jiang Si's shoulder and continued, "That thief can't show himself, so he'll probably go after Weiyang Palace and Xuan Yue Sect. Don't worry, I've already instructed the disciples of Weiyang Palace not to accept any bloody missions from Kunlun Ruins or Qingfeng Sword Sect before I return."
Jiang Si nodded to Xuan Yi, and immediately clasped his hands together with Li Hengzhi, saying, "Thank you."
After Xi Ming revealed the secret he had kept in his heart, it was as if the spirit hidden in his body had also dissipated, and he became somewhat listless.
"They say we are fearless of wind and rain, whether the wind or rain is at our door or not, but I'm afraid we won't make it through this time."
Bai Heming noticed the old man's fatigue and drowsiness, and carefully helped him lie down on the straw mat so that Xi Ming could get some rest.
Afraid of disturbing Xi Ming's rest, the four of them filed out through the crack and stood on the flat ground outside. Looking into the distance, they saw that it was already dawn.
"What do we do next?" Xuan Yi leaned against the crack, toying with the bone whistle in his hand.
“We definitely need to visit the historical sites, but Senior Xi’s injury can’t be delayed any longer,” Bai Heming said after thinking for a moment.
"You want to split your forces into two groups? How?"
Bai Heming pondered for a moment, "You and Hengzhi go find the ancient ruins, while Jiang Si and I will take Senior Xi out of the mountain."
"Huh?" Xuan Yi seemed not to have heard clearly, and pointed to himself. "Me and Li Hengzhi?"
"Alright, Lao Bai, I know you mean well, but I won't join in the fun this time. Same as always, you and Li Hengzhi stay together, and Jiang Si and I will take the old man away."
“It’s dawn. Manniang has probably already discovered that Xuanyi and I are missing. If you want to go deeper into the mountains, you need to set off as soon as possible,” Jiang Si reminded him from the side.
“Alright, let’s go say goodbye to Senior Xi and leave right away.” Li Hengzhi led Bai Heming and turned to walk into the crevice.
Xuan Yi, who had remained where he was, nudged Jiang Si and asked in a low voice, "What do you think about Lao Bai and Li Hengzhi's situation?"
Jiang Si was somewhat confused. "Hengzhi and Young Master Bai's meeting was not easy, but after hardship comes happiness, and things will only get better from now on."
“That’s true.” Xuan Yi stroked his chin, but didn’t say anything more.
However, based on his understanding of that rigid and acerbic old man with a white beard in Kunlun Ruins, it's hard to say.
A short while later, the two of them came out with happy expressions.
"Senior Xi just told us that if we climb a short distance to the side, there's a hidden path." Bai Heming said excitedly, turning to Jiang Si and Xuan Yi earnestly.
"Moreover, there is a stream at the bottom of the cliff. If you walk east along the bottom of the cliff, there is a safe way out of the mountain."
Xuan Yi patted Bai Heming on the shoulder and handed him a mechanical bird. "Okay, be careful in everything you do."
Bai Heming took the mechanical bird and smiled confidently, "Give us three days. We'll meet at the inn on the third night."
After he finished speaking, he followed behind Li Hengzhi and climbed up the ground to the side using both hands and feet.
Jiang Si and Xuan Yi immediately sprang into action. Jiang Si returned to the cave, carried Xi Ming on his back, and wrapped Xi Ming with strips of cloth just in case.
Carrying some necessities that he had simply packed from the cave, Xuan Yi took the lead in climbing down the cliff from the platform.
And the other side.
After Manniang captured the two people last night, thinking of the Great Shaman's preferences, she immediately went to report to the Great Shaman with a fawning expression, saying that she would take the two people to offer to the Great Shaman today.
But when Manniang discovered that no one was guarding the cave entrance, she felt a chill run down her spine. She quickly entered the cave, but the people inside had already vanished. She was instantly furious, but then a chill ran down her spine. If the Great Shaman hadn't seen these two, she feared she would be the one to suffer.
Thinking of this, Manniang became even more anxious and hurriedly shouted to the people behind her, "Quickly, send people to search. Due to the influence of the poisonous fog, they can't have gone far."
